Fargo, ND vs Phoenix, AZ
Cost of Living Comparison
Fargo, ND is more affordable by 12.4 index points
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Category | Fargo, ND | Phoenix, AZ |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Overall | 90.9 | 103.3 | -12.4 |
| Housing | 81.1 | 121.2 | -40.1 |
| Goods | 95.7 | 95.0 | +0.6 |
| Utilities | 77.3 | 93.3 | -16.0 |
| Other Services | 91.3 | 104.0 | -12.7 |
Income & Housing Comparison
| Metric | Fargo, ND | Phoenix, AZ |
|---|---|---|
| Median Household Income | $73,641 | $79,935 |
| Median Home Value | $261,000 | $360,600 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$919 | $1,432 |
| Per Capita Income | $41,687 | $40,787 |
